The government has notified the Goods and Services Tax Appellate Tribunal (Procedure) Rules.
It provides for mandatory e-filing of applications and conducting hearings in a hybrid mode.
The rules also provide that any urgent matter filed by an applicant before 12:00 noon shall be listed before the Appellate Tribunal on the following working day, if the application is complete in all respects.
In exceptional cases, the application may be received after 12:00 noon but before 3:00 p.m. for listing on the following day, with the specific permission of the Appellate Tribunal or President.
The administrative offices of the Appellate Tribunal will remain open on all working days according to the GST Appellate Tribunal (Procedure) Rules, 2025.
In May last year, the government had appointed Justice (Retd) Sanjaya Kumar Mishra as the first President of the GST Appellate Tribunal (GSTAT).
